MessageKyoto Muse
My Uncle used to travel to Japan as a Greek merchant marine and would return with gorgeous dolls for my Mom. The beauty of the dolls captivated me from an early age and they have regularly starred as subjects within my art practice. Originating from an appreciation for modern Japanese design, I created this portrait over ten years ago in a serendipitous combination of finding online inspiration and an eclectic jackpot of supplies. It is one of two figurative collages I created at the time, that jumpstarted my creative process and paved the way for my present work. This image is an acknowledgement of that significant milestone and all that has followed in my personal and professional journey since then. Traveling to Japan some years later and visiting Gion, the geisha district of Kyoto, was a lifelong dream come true. I believe that listening to our creative muse leads us towards the actions that ultimately help us fulfill our dreams.
Materials include:
Papyrus
Decorative paper
Printer paper
Plastic discs
Jeweled brads and beaded embellishments
